As a girl she looked up at him with childlike puppy love, As a teenager she fell in love with his lips that drank so deeply of her, As a lady she handed over her hand and felt it enclosed in such strength, As a woman she gave her body that craved for his without thought, As His woman she opened her soul and let him take it to live with his in his safe keeping.
All because he looked into her and learned her mind, saw her strength and protected her weekness, discovered her body and showed her how to feel all she could.
